Kassenbuch, ustva, Erstattungsschreiben

This commit is contained in:
2025-01-08 14:42:54 +01:00
parent fc538afc19
commit be6487d129
8 changed files with 14 additions and 9 deletions

View File

@@ -1687,9 +1687,10 @@ Public Class cFakturierung
End If End If
End If End If
If RECHNUNG.ANHAENGE.Count > 0 Then If RECHNUNG.ANHAENGE.Count > 0 Then
If (RECHNUNG.[DruckDatumZeit] Is Nothing OrElse vbYes = MsgBox("Anhänge drucken?", vbYesNoCancel)) Then 'wird nicht mehr benötigt! TicketNr: 953
printRGAnhaenge(RECHNUNG) 'If (RECHNUNG.[DruckDatumZeit] Is Nothing OrElse vbYes = MsgBox("Anhänge drucken?", vbYesNoCancel)) Then
End If ' printRGAnhaenge(RECHNUNG)
'End If
End If End If
End If End If

View File

@@ -115,14 +115,14 @@ Public Class ustCntlUSTV_AntragPosition
save = False save = False
End If End If
If txtUmrechnungskurs._value <> "" Then If txtUmrechnungskurs._value <> "" Then
UStV_POS.UStVPo_Umrechnungskurs = txtUmrechnungskurs._value UStV_POS.UStVPo_Umrechnungskurs = txtUmrechnungskurs._value.Replace(",", ".")
Else Else
save = False save = False
End If End If
UStV_POS.UStVPo_Schnittstelle = cbxAPI.Checked UStV_POS.UStVPo_Schnittstelle = cbxAPI.Checked
UStV_POS.UStVPo_SchnittstellenNr = IIf(cboSchnittstellennr.SelectedItem Is Nothing, cboSchnittstellennr.SelectedItem, -1) UStV_POS.UStVPo_SchnittstellenNr = IIf(cboSchnittstellennr.SelectedItem IsNot Nothing, cboSchnittstellennr._value, -1)
End Sub End Sub
@@ -141,7 +141,8 @@ Public Class ustCntlUSTV_AntragPosition
gridAktiv = False gridAktiv = False
txtUSTBetragEUR._value = "" txtUSTBetragEUR._value = ""
If IsNumeric(txtUSTBetrag._value) AndAlso IsNumeric(txtUmrechnungskurs._value) Then If IsNumeric(txtUSTBetrag._value) AndAlso IsNumeric(txtUmrechnungskurs._value) Then
txtUSTBetragEUR._value = txtUSTBetrag._value * txtUmrechnungskurs._value txtUSTBetragEUR.Text = Math.Floor((txtUSTBetrag._value / txtUmrechnungskurs._value) * 100 + 0.5) / 100
'txtUSTBetragEUR._value = txtUSTBetrag._value * txtUmrechnungskurs._value
End If End If
gridAktiv = gridAktivTMP gridAktiv = gridAktivTMP
End Sub End Sub

View File

@@ -1,5 +1,4 @@
Imports DocumentFormat.OpenXml.Drawing Imports SDL.RKSVServer
Imports SDL.RKSVServer
Public Class frmKassenbuch Public Class frmKassenbuch
Dim SQL As New SQL Dim SQL As New SQL
@@ -630,6 +629,8 @@ Public Class frmKassenbuch
print.Text = "Kassenbuch" print.Text = "Kassenbuch"
Dim rpt As New rptKassenbuchKontenBericht Dim rpt As New rptKassenbuchKontenBericht
rpt.PageSettings.PaperKind = GrapeCity.ActiveReports.Printing.PaperKind.A4
Dim frmVonBis As New frmKasseBerichtVonBis Dim frmVonBis As New frmKasseBerichtVonBis
If frmVonBis.ShowDialog(Me) <> Windows.Forms.DialogResult.OK Then If frmVonBis.ShowDialog(Me) <> Windows.Forms.DialogResult.OK Then
Exit Sub Exit Sub

View File

@@ -35,10 +35,12 @@ Public Class usrCntlSeriendruck
Dim bericht As cErstasttungsschreiben = berichteSQL.getErstatung(txtErstattungAbfNrFiliale_neu.Text, txtErstattungAbfNr_neu.Text, txtErstattungAbfUnterNr_neu.Text) Dim bericht As cErstasttungsschreiben = berichteSQL.getErstatung(txtErstattungAbfNrFiliale_neu.Text, txtErstattungAbfNr_neu.Text, txtErstattungAbfUnterNr_neu.Text)
Dim FIRMA As New VERAG_PROG_ALLGEMEIN.cFirmen(19) Dim FIRMA As New VERAG_PROG_ALLGEMEIN.cFirmen(19)
Dim FIRMA_DE As New VERAG_PROG_ALLGEMEIN.cFirmen(2)
'Dim ADRESSE = New VERAG_PROG_ALLGEMEIN.cAdressen(bericht.) 'Dim ADRESSE = New VERAG_PROG_ALLGEMEIN.cAdressen(bericht.)
If FIRMA IsNot Nothing Then If FIRMA IsNot Nothing Then
WordDoc.FormFields("txtAdresseZeileFirma").Range.Text = FIRMA.Firma_Bez + ", " + FIRMA.Firma_Ort WordDoc.FormFields("txtAdresseZeileFirma").Range.Text = FIRMA.Firma_Bez + ", " + FIRMA.Firma_Ort + ", " + FIRMA.Firma_Straße
WordDoc.FormFields("txtAdresseZeileFirm1").Range.Text = FIRMA_DE.Firma_Bez + ", " + FIRMA_DE.Firma_Ort + ", " + FIRMA_DE.Firma_Straße
End If End If